  • Iphoto lost photos when it unexpectedly stopped??

    Hello,
         I recently got a MacBook Pro and it was all going good, until now.  So I have a camera and whenever I import my photos, I import them into iphoto. Lately it has been quitting unexpectedly, but it never lost any of my images.  This time, I just imported about 400 photos and when it was done importing it asked if i wanted to delete them from my memory card and I said yes. After it deleted them from the memory card, it "quit unexpectedly" and when I re-opened iphoto there was just two folders in my events from what I just imported and nothing in them.
         I've looked in last import, trash and folders from the iphoto library in finder.  This is really frustrating and I'm wondering if there's a way to save my photos! If anyone knows please help!
    Thanks,
    Lewx2

    Option 1
    Back Up and try rebuild the library: hold down the command and option (or alt) keys while launching iPhoto. Use the resulting dialogue to rebuild. Choose to Repair Database. If that doesn't help, then try again, this time using Rebuild Database.
    If that fails:
    Option 2
    Download iPhoto Library Manager and use its rebuild function. (In Library Manager it's the FIle -> Rebuild command)
    This will create an entirely new library. It will then copy (or try to) your photos and all the associated metadata and versions to this new Library, and arrange it as close as it can to what you had in the damaged Library. It does this based on information it finds in the iPhoto sharing mechanism - but that means that things not shared won't be there, so no slideshows, books or calendars, for instance - but it should get all your events, albums and keywords, faces and places back.
    Because this process creates an entirely new library and leaves your old one untouched, it is non-destructive, and if you're not happy with the results you can simply return to your old one.

  • Lost photos when updated to iOS 5

    I updated mine and my husband's iPhone 4 this weekend to iOS 5.  We both had photos on our phones that were not previously dumped onto our PC hard drive.  My photos were still there, but my husband's are gone.  iTunes said the phone was backing up the phone, so they must be somewhere, but we just can't find out how to get them back.  The Genius Bar was unhelpful, so I was wondering if this happened to anyone else and what you did to get them back (if you were able to)?

    First things first, go to Settings > General > About. Look at photos. If it reads how many you originally had, they should be on your iPhone, just not showing up in the Photos app. This happened to me, it confused me very much, how could my Settings read that I had nearly 530 photos, but only about 150 actually show up? They were even in this tab called events, which disappeared when I did these two steps, which seem to have resolved my problem:
    1) Sign into iCloud and turn on photo stream.
    2) Power cycle the iPhone. (I think this is the step that actually resolved my problem)
    Like I said above, I think step 2 is what actually resolved my problem, as with many iDevices, a simple power cycle seems to resolve many issues. From what I have read online, it seems that when iTunes restores your iPhone after the iOS5 update, it relocates your photos to a different folder, which will be found after a power cycle. Once your phone powers back on, go into the Photos app and check for your photos, they should be there and in the original order they were in before the update! I hope this helps you, good luck!
